Automotive Paint Technicians are responsible for the preparation and painting of vehicles, ensuring that the vehicles are painted accurately and in accordance with the specifications set by the customer. Automotive Paint Technicians must have excellent attention to detail and work independently. They are also responsible for conducting repairs and general maintenance of automotive paint equipment and work with other technicians to ensure that the vehicles meet the customer’s needs. Automotive Paint Technicians are an important part of the collision repair cycle.
